Home Bancorp (HBCP) Loans - Net: 2016-2025

Historic Loans - Net for Home Bancorp (HBCP) over the last 10 years, with Sep 2025 value amounting to $2.7 billion.

  • Home Bancorp's Loans - Net rose 1.41% to $2.7 billion in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was $2.7 billion, marking a year-over-year increase of 1.41%. This contributed to the annual value of $2.7 billion for FY2024, which is 5.30% up from last year.
  • Latest data reveals that Home Bancorp reported Loans - Net of $2.7 billion as of Q3 2025, which was down 2.13% from $2.7 billion recorded in Q2 2025.
  • In the past 5 years, Home Bancorp's Loans - Net registered a high of $2.7 billion during Q2 2025, and its lowest value of $1.8 billion during Q4 2021.
  • Its 3-year average for Loans - Net is $2.6 billion, with a median of $2.6 billion in 2024.
  • Per our database at Business Quant, Home Bancorp's Loans - Net declined by 6.57% in 2021 and then soared by 32.02% in 2022.
  • Home Bancorp's Loans - Net (Quarterly) stood at $1.8 billion in 2021, then soared by 32.02% to $2.4 billion in 2022, then climbed by 6.19% to $2.6 billion in 2023, then climbed by 5.30% to $2.7 billion in 2024, then increased by 1.41% to $2.7 billion in 2025.
